Heater Unit/Core Replacement

SRS components are located in this area. Review the SRS component locations (see COMPONENT LOCATION INDEX ) and the precautions and procedures (see PRECAUTIONS AND PROCEDURES ) before doing repairs or service.

  1. Do the battery terminal disconnection procedure (see «BATTERY TERMINAL DISCONNECTION AND RECONNECTION»(/acura/rl/ii-2008-2012/remont/body-electrical/#battery) ).
  2. Disconnect the A/C lines from the evaporator core (see «EVAPORATOR CORE REPLACEMENT»(/acura/rl/ii-2008-2012/remont/automatic-hvac-system/#hvac-heating-ventilation-air-conditioning) ).
  3. From under the hood open the cable clamp (A), then disconnect the heater valve cable (B) from the heater valve arm (C). Turn the heater valve arm to the fully opened position as shown.
  4. When the engine is cool, drain the engine coolant from the radiator (see «COOLANT CHECK»(/acura/rl/ii-2008-2012/remont/cooling-system-mechanical/#cooling-system) ).
  5. Slide the hose clamps (A) back. Remove the bolt and the water valve bracket, then disconnect the inlet heater hose (B) and the outlet heater hose (C) from the heater unit. Engine coolant will run out when the hoses are disconnected; drain it into a clean drip pan. Be sure not to let coolant spill on the electrical parts or the painted surfaces. If any coolant spills, rinse it off immediately.
  6. Remove the mounting nut from the heater unit. Take care not to damage or bend the fuel lines and the brake lines, etc.
  7. Remove the dashboard (see «DASHBOARD REPLACEMENT»(/acura/rl/ii-2008-2012/remont/exteriorinterior-trim/#dashboard) ).
  8. Disconnect the connectors (A) from the adaptive front lighting control unit, the electronically controlled power steering control unit, and the daytime running lights control unit. Remove the relay (B), the bolt, and the self-tapping screws, then remove the bracket (C).
  9. Disconnect the connectors (A) from the driver's cool vent control motor, the driver's air mix control motor, the mode control motor, and the evaporator temperature sensor, then remove the wire harness clips (B).
  10. Disconnect the connectors (A) from the blower motor, the power transistor, the control motor relay, the throttle actuator control module subharness, and the dashboard wire harnesses. Remove the self-tapping screw (B), the connector clip (C) and the wire harness clips (D).
  11. Disconnect the connectors (A) from the recirculation control motor, the passenger's cool vent control motor, the passenger's air mix control motor, and the rear vent control motor, and then remove the wire harness clip (B) and the wire harness (C).
  12. Remove the clips (A), the mounting nuts, and the blower-heater unit (B).
  13. Remove the self-tapping screws and the passenger's heater duct (A), then remove the expansion valve cover (B), the bolts, and the expansion valve (C). Remove the self-tapping screws, the joint duct (D), and the heater core cover (E). Remove the self-tapping screws, the heater pipe brackets (F), and the grommets (G), then carefully pull out the heater core (H).
  14. Install the heater core and the evaporator core in the reverse order of removal.
  15. Install the heater unit in the reverse order of removal, and note these items: Do not interchange the inlet and the outlet heater hoses, and install the hose clamps securely. Refill the cooling system with engine coolant (see «COOLANT CHECK»(/acura/rl/ii-2008-2012/remont/cooling-system-mechanical/#cooling-system) ). Adjust the heater valve cable (see «HEATER VALVE CABLE ADJUSTMENT»(/acura/rl/ii-2008-2012/remont/automatic-hvac-system/#hvac-heating-ventilation-air-conditioning) ). Make sure that there is no coolant leakage. Make sure that there is no air leakage.
  16. Do the battery terminal reconnection procedure (see «BATTERY TERMINAL DISCONNECTION AND RECONNECTION»(/acura/rl/ii-2008-2012/remont/body-electrical/#battery) ).

  1. From under the hood, open the cable clamp (A), then disconnect the heater valve cable (B) from the heater valve arm (C).
  2. From under the dash, disconnect the heater valve cable housing from the cable clamp (A), and disconnect the heater valve cable (B) from the air mix control linkage (C).
  3. Set the temperature control button to Max Cool (Lo) with the ignition switch to ON (II).
  4. Attach the heater valve cable (B) to the air mix control linkage (C) as shown in step 2. Hold the end of the heater valve cable housing against the stop (D), then snap the heater valve cable housing into the cable clamp (A). NOTE: Make sure the ring-end of the cable is pushed all the way to the base of the pin on the air mix control linkage.
  5. From under the hood, turn the heater valve arm (A) to the fully closed position as shown, and hold it. Attach the heater valve cable (B) to the heater valve arm, and gently pull on the heater valve cable housing to take up any slack, then install the heater valve cable housing into the cable clamp (C).
